What to consider when choosing a stationery-designer in San Bernardino

What to look for in a wedding stationery designer

When choosing a stationery designer in San Bernardino, prioritize custom design capabilities, print quality, turnaround time, and familiarity with local venues. Planner Miguel Alvarez notes, "Designers who know how to incorporate San Bernardino’s unique scenery—like desert blooms or Mission-style architecture—can make invitations feel truly rooted here." It's also helpful if the designer offers digital and print options, especially for couples managing remote RSVPs.

Booking timeline based on our research

Most couples in San Bernardino begin working with stationery designers 6 to 8 months before their wedding. Expect to budget between $500 and $1,200 depending on the complexity and the number of pieces. Save-the-dates typically go out 8 months prior, while invitations should be mailed 2 to 3 months ahead of the event. Spring and early summer weddings are the busiest, so earlier booking is advised during those months.
